How Our Crawl Space Water Extraction Service Works

When you call our team for crawl space water extraction, we'll send a certified technician to assess the situation and devel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ry your crawl space. Our process involves several key steps: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We'll evaluate the extent of the water damage, identify potential safety hazards, and develop a comprehensive plan to extract the water and dry your crawl space. Our technician will explain the process, timeline, and costs involved, so you know exactly what to expect.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We'll use advanced equ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and wet/dry vacuums, to remove standing water from your crawl space. Our technician will carefully navigate the space to ensure all areas are thoroughly cleaned.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We'll employ specialized equipment to dry your crawl space, including indust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home remains safe and d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technician will thoroughly clean and sanitize your crawl space, removing any remaining debris, dirt, or contaminants. This step is essential in preventing future mold growth and ensuring your home remains healthy.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Documentation

Once the work is complete, our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ure your crawl space is dry, clean, and safe. We'll also provide you with a detailed report and documentation of the work performed.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Extraction

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age in your crawl space can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and structural damage. Be aware of these common indicators: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your crawl space can show mold growth or water accumulation. Don't ignore these signs, as they can lead to serious health risks.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your crawl space walls, floors, or ceilings can show water dam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ring in your crawl space can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to structural issues and costly repairs if left unchecked.

Visible Puddles or Standing Water

Visible puddles or standing water in your crawl space can show a serious issue. Don't wait, call our team for prompt help.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ds coming from your crawl space, such as dripping or gurgling sounds, can show water accumulation. Don't 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s.

Visible Mold or Mildew

Visible mold or mildew growth in your crawl space can show a serious health risk. Don't wait, call our team for prompt help.

Crawl Space Water Extraction Cost in Willo Historic District, AZ

The cost of crawl space water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Willo Historic District, AZ.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, but actual costs may be higher or lower, depending on the specifics of your situation. We offer free on-site assessments to provide you with a more accurate qu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 - $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Drying and Dehumidification $300 - $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 - $800 Size of affected area, type of contaminants
Final Inspection and Documentation $100 - $300 Complexity of the job, number of technicians involved
Emergency Response (after-hours or weekend) $500 - $1,500 Time of day, day of the week, severity of the issue

Keep in mind that these estimates are subject to change based on your specific situation. We offer free on-site assessments to provide you with a more accurate quote and ensure you receive the best possible service.

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Extraction

Q: What causes water damage in crawl spaces?

A: Water damage in crawl spaces can be caused by heavy rainfall, burst pipes, appliance malfunctions, or poor drainage. It's essential to address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Q: How long does it take to dry a crawl space?

A: The drying time for a crawl space depends on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to ensure your crawl space is dry and safe within 3-5 days.

Q: Is crawl space water extraction covered by insurance?

A: Yes, crawl space water extraction may be covered by your homeowners insurance policy. But, it's essential to review your policy and consult with your insurance provider to find out the extent of coverage.

Q: Can I prevent water damage in my crawl space?

A: Yes, you can take proactive measures to prevent water damage in your crawl space. Regularly inspect your crawl space for signs of water accumulation, ensure proper drainage, and address any issues quickly.

Q: How do I know if I need professional help for crawl space water extraction?

A: If you notice any signs of water damage, such as musty odors, water stains, or warped flooring, it's essential to call a professional for help. Our team will evaluate the situation and provide you with a customized plan to ensure your crawl space is safe and dry.
